New issue
Advanced search Search tips
Note: Color blocks (like or ) mean that a user may not be available. Tooltip shows the reason.

Issue 788656 link

Starred by 3 users

Issue metadata

Status: Fixed
Owner:
Last visit > 30 days ago
Closed: Nov 2017
Cc:
Components:
EstimatedDays: ----
NextAction: ----
OS: Linux , Windows
Pri: 1
Type: Bug-Regression



Sign in to add a comment

Regression: Able to navigate to other links/pages when Add to Desktop overlay is present

Project Member Reported by sc00335...@techmahindra.com, Nov 27 2017

Issue description

Chrome Version: 64.0.3278.0
OS: Windows, Linux

What steps will reproduce the problem?
(1) Navigate to any webpage >> Click on 3 dot menu
(2) More tools >> select Add to Desktop 
(3) Click on any links on background tab or open new tab and observe

Expected: Should not be able to interact with background tab and open new tab or exit chrome.

Actual: Instead able to interact with other links and tabs present.

NOTE: Add to desktop option is not available in Mac

This is a regression issue broken in M64.

Good Build: 64.0.3270.0
Bad Build: 64.0.3271.0

You are probably looking for a change made after 517017 (known good), but no later than 517018 (first known bad).
CHANGELOG URL:
 https://chromium.googlesource.com/chromium/src/+log/f01395ff3538341da0ea9eec0978a15afa26f3e2..556227a5a0ebb6a048b8ae89648b306a88f74c84

Reviewed-on: https://chromium-review.googlesource.com/726958

Suspecting same from changelog.

@mcgreevy: Please confirm whether this is an issue or intended change.

Adding RB-Stable as this is a recent regression. Please remove if not the case.

Thanks!
 
Actual_add to desktop.ogv
961 KB View Download
Expected_add to desktop.ogv
899 KB View Download
Thanks for the report. This is an unintended change. I'm preparing a fix now.
Project Member

Comment 2 by bugdroid1@chromium.org, Nov 28 2017

The following revision refers to this bug:
  https://chromium.googlesource.com/chromium/src.git/+/ba884046d8371d4327e034d57ca097c520b240a3

commit ba884046d8371d4327e034d57ca097c520b240a3
Author: Michael McGreevy <mcgreevy@chromium.org>
Date: Tue Nov 28 05:47:02 2017

Make app install dialogs modal.

The dialogs should be tab modal, but don't currently attach properly to
the WebContentsModalDialogManager.
Using ShowWebModalDialogViews(..) fixes the attachment.

Bug:  788656 
Change-Id: Ib4fcb4c5597e831fad027364b278f1f28be89dae
Reviewed-on: https://chromium-review.googlesource.com/792370
Commit-Queue: Michael McGreevy <mcgreevy@chromium.org>
Reviewed-by: Trent Apted <tapted@chromium.org>
Cr-Commit-Position: refs/heads/master@{#519583}
[modify] https://crrev.com/ba884046d8371d4327e034d57ca097c520b240a3/chrome/browser/ui/views/extensions/bookmark_app_confirmation_view.cc
[modify] https://crrev.com/ba884046d8371d4327e034d57ca097c520b240a3/chrome/browser/ui/views/extensions/pwa_confirmation_view.cc
[modify] https://crrev.com/ba884046d8371d4327e034d57ca097c520b240a3/chrome/browser/ui/views/extensions/pwa_confirmation_view_browsertest.cc

Status: Fixed (was: Assigned)

Sign in to add a comment